The commute from Maidstone

Direct trains from Maidstone East take around 55 minutes into London Victoria, running on Southeastern. That makes it #85 out of 120 towns for speed into London.

An annual season ticket costs about £5,865, roughly £489 a month or £29,325 over five years. That's 16% more expensive than the 120-town median of £5,065.

Data (June 2026): house prices are HM Land Registry averages by postcode district; train times are typical off-peak direct rail to London terminals (National Rail); season tickets are the annual price to a London terminal; the crime index comes from ONS / police.uk (0 = very safe, 100 = very high crime); broadband is the Ofcom Connected Nations median download speed; life satisfaction is the ONS Personal Well-being mean score for the local authority. Figures are approximate estimates for comparison.
